Fort Lauderdale to Charlotte

1h 41m The flight from Fort Lauderdale Hollywood International Airport (FLL) to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T) covers 1,019 km (633 miles) and takes approximately 1h 41m gate to gate for a typical jet.

The route heads north on an initial great-circle bearing of 356°, passing near 30.6° N, 80.5° W at its midpoint.

Flight time at different cruise speeds

Aircraft type, winds and routing all move the real number. This is the same distance flown at different speeds, plus the 25-minute ground and climb allowance.

Typical ofCruise speedAirborneGate to gate
Turboprop / regional550 km/h1h 51m2h 16m
Narrowbody jet (A320, 737)780 km/h1h 18m1h 44m
Widebody jet (777, 787, A350)900 km/h1h 08m1h 33m
Private jet (Gulfstream)850 km/h1h 12m1h 37m

Headwinds on an eastbound long-haul routinely add 30–60 minutes; the same route westbound can be quicker. Airlines publish schedules with padding built in.

How far is Fort Lauderdale from Charlotte?

1,019 kilometres in a straight line over the earth's surface — 633 miles or 550 nautical miles. Actual flown distance is usually 2–5% longer because aircraft follow airways, avoid weather and route around restricted airspace.
